Transaction 57a830b91c18aa8ac1e77c275e3e234445cf96223386e82b6b769d36f72d4510

4 Input
1 Outputs
  • 57a830b91c18aa8ac1e77c275e3e234445cf96223386e82b6b769d36f72d4510:0
  • value  158487
    address  3GV853XGWATJUwPKMxiTkJ4j2Q8tWUhyP3